    The Wise County Courthouse is located in Decatur, Texas, United States of America. This historic courthouse, built in 1896, is a beautiful example of Second Empire architectural style. It is the centerpiece of downtown Decatur and an important landmark in Wise County.

  • Wise County Heritage Museum

    Located near the courthouse, the Wise County Heritage Museum showcases the rich heritage and culture of the county. It features exhibits on local history, including Native American artifacts, pioneer life, and the impact of the oil industry on the region.
  • Lyndon B. Johnson National Grassland

    For nature lovers, the Lyndon B. Johnson National Grassland is a must-visit attraction near Wise County. This vast wilderness area spans over 20,000 acres and offers opportunities for hiking, birdwatching, and wildlife spotting.
